First time on your page. Great job. Depending on how much you need to add but I would add soil to a desired level and then I like to top dress Kelp. If there is something lacking then kelp should take care of it. I use a few tablespoons in a 7 gallon pot. I have also added a quality EWC "sludge" I make by bubbling my castings with an airlift for over 24 hours. I put it on thick...about an inch or so. Both of these are great "fix it" options for organics. Just watch topdressing late in flower because it can cause unwanted fox-tailing . HTH

Tommy! Thank you, I appreciate the help. I definitely have at least another month (30+days) before chop. 40+ on a couple of them for sure..Too late to topdress in your opinion?
 
Tommy! Thank you, I appreciate the help. I definitely have at least another month (30+days) before chop. 40+ on a couple of them for sure..Too late to topdress in your opinion?
When it comes to topdressing I stop 3-4 weeks from harvest. I do not see the point after this because if you made it this far with no topdress...the plant should be able to finish without. Most organic products take 2-3 weeks to start to work, when you topdress. Making a tea is different and more instant. I have large pots and topdress during the first few weeks of flower. this will carry me through flower with little effort.
